After an uninterrupted ten years of travelling freely around the world pretty much at my own set pace, eventually making my way in and out of the border towns of more than eighty countries worldwide, I came looking for my own personal paradise to settle upon, right where my journey began, right here in Belize. The truth of the matter is that it was not until my eighth visit to the Central American country of Belize, that I finally took time aside to checkout the Toledo District firsthand. Although I had travelled unscathed throughout the districts of Belize many times as previously mentioned, in all my adventuring from the Cayo to the Cayes, I had never once ventured south of Monkey River Town. Somehow I always got caught up in Placencia. To this day the place and the people still have a way of doing that to me. Seemingly I too was concerned about guidebook stories of torrential rainfall, of an overly abundant insect population laying in prey for the new arrivals, not to mention the sheer realities of the remoteness of the region. That of course was way back when the entire length of the Southern Highway was a lonesome dirt road.

The last unpaved miles
Today the roads leading south from Belize City to Punta Gorda are almost completely paved. As of this writing, there are less than about ten miles of the Southern Highway remaining to be surfaced. Indeed, changes are in the wind, even the guy who writes ‘The Rough Guide to Belize’ has settled on Southern Belize. All in all, the point I guess I’m trying to make is that there probably is no escaping the fact that in the end your own personal paradise still comes with a fair share of rainy days. That’s why everything is so beautifully tropical green. Maybe the real art of living life to the fullest is how one manages all the clouds. |
